ABOUT THE PARK
Located in the mountains of Pocahontas County, Watoga State Park is West Virginia’s largest state park. With 10,100 acres of land, Watoga is filled with many recreational activities including hiking, swimming, fishing and boating. Watoga Lake is known for excellent fishing opportunities and is part of the Division of Natural Resources' stocking program. A multipurpose building, museum and observation tower are just a few of the unique attractions at Watoga State Park.
